Radish Cucumber Salad
Radishes seem to be an overlooked vegetable. It may be the fact that if not picked and eaten at a particular time in their growth, they can be bitter and/or woody. However at the right stage, they are tasty and have a tender crunch. Tossed with cucumber, sweet onion and a vinaigrette, the simple but colorful combination makes a wonderful chopped salad to complement a grilled entree.
